The Los Angeles Dodgers are reportedly interested in acquiring pitcher Antonio Senzatela from the Colorado Rockies due to ongoing injuries within their rotation. Senzatela, 31, is having an unexpected breakout season with a 1.30 ERA and significantly improved control. Despite a history of being an average pitcher, his performance this year has made him a target for contending teams. With the trade deadline approaching in August, Senzatela may be available for the right price. The Dodgers have shown a history of seeking pitching upgrades and could benefit from his potential contribution.
- •Senzatela holds a 1.30 ERA with 26 strikeouts this season.
- •He has reduced home runs allowed from 1.5 to 0.5 per nine innings.
- •Trade deadline for MLB teams is set for early August.
- •The Dodgers have a history of adding pitching help before the deadline.
